All the Right Moves ( Alternative title: Since moving I fully from it; Original Title: All the Right Moves ) is an American sports drama from 1983, directed by Michael Chapman, wrote the screenplay Michael Kane..

Background

  • The film was shot in the spring of 1983 in Pennsylvania. Locations were: Conemaugh, Johnstown and Pittsburgh. He played in the cinemas of the United States an approximately 17.23 million U.S. dollars.
  • The steel crisis hit Pennsylvania, the epitome of economic power in the U.S., particularly hard and led to the decline of entire cities.
